Arequipa, after Lima, is the second region in the country that obtained the most medals in the general computation of the National School Sports Games (JDEN) 2017, which took place in the capital of the Republic.

According to the technical report from the Ministry of Education (Minedu), students from Arequipa won 71 medals, 18 gold, 23 silver, and 31 bronze, while Lima won a total of 155, of which 63 were gold, 51 silver, and 41 bronze.

Third place was Piura with 53 medals; then Junín and Lambayeque, both with 11; while Loreto achieved 9.

In this fifth edition of the JDEN, the participation of six teams from indigenous communities in the women's soccer tournament was highlighted. The members of the champion in this category are from the Quechua community Chanka (Ayacucho) representing the schools José Carlos Mariátegui, San José Bendezú, Mauro Rondines, Oswaldo Regla Cárdenas, and Porfirio Meneses, from the UGEL Huanta.

The sports event lasted two weeks and took place simultaneously at the facilities of La Videna, Campo de Marte, Universidad de Lima, and the Ricardo Palma school, with the participation of approximately 2,500 students from different regions of the country.
